CBOE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review

277 of the 3,812 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cboe Global Markets (CBOE)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$3.96B — up 0.95% from $3.93B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 41 funds opened new CBOE positions and 30 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 109 added to existing stakes and 89 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Westpac Banking Corp, adding an estimated $128M. The largest seller was Lazard Asset Management, cutting an estimated $63M.
